**Ticket: Sticky bucketing drift in Splitwise Assigner**

New users enrolled in experiment cohorts via the Splitwise Assigner service are occasionally re-bucketed after a session refresh. This breaks assignment stickiness and skews variant metrics for the Parrotleaf checkout test. Reproduces roughly once per 400 sessions on staging. The offending build is identified below for bisecting.

trace token, fafog-kageg: htk4_98e6

**Alert: SnackRoute restock planner stalled**

Heads up, new folks — SnackRoute generates the nightly restock routes for our vending fleet, and this alert fires when the planner hasn't produced a plan by 02:00. Drivers then fall back to yesterday's routes, which usually means a few machines run dry by afternoon. First step: check the planner job logs, then the inventory feed. If both look fine, escalate with the run timestamp to the logistics on-call inbox.

escalation mailbox, fafof-bahip: tamael@ordincorp.test

CI note — firmware update channel (Orvex devices). The beta channel publisher fails when the manifest signer rotates mid-build; stale key cached by the runner. Fix: clear the signer cache step before publish, added in pipeline v14. If manifests still fail verification, rerun from the sign stage, not from scratch. The last known-good publish token follows.

build token for haduf-bafog: htk21_2d98ce91a83676b65394a

Subject: Tracing cut-over — done!

Hi all,

Quick recap for those who joined recently: last night we moved all Pondermill services off the old homegrown tracer and onto SpanLattice. Every request now carries a propagated context header end-to-end, so you can actually follow a call from the gateway to the billing worker. A few dashboards still show gaps — that's cached data, not a bug. If you run a service locally, point your agent at the shared collector using these configuration values.

service settings:
PRAIX_LOG_LEVEL=error
PRAIX_METRICS_HOST=metrics.praix.qorvelcorp.corp
PRAIX_POOL_SIZE=16